Why Appliances Matter During a Restaurant Health Inspection
Health inspections focus on food safety, sanitation, temperature control, contamination prevention, and facility conditions. Appliances play a direct role in all of these areas.
For example, refrigeration equipment helps keep time and temperature control for safety foods cold. Dishwashers and warewashing equipment help clean and sanitize utensils, plates, and kitchen tools. Ovens, ranges, and hot holding equipment support safe cooking and holding temperatures. Ice machines, prep tables, and food processors come into direct or indirect contact with food and must remain clean.
In other words, appliances are often where food safety problems become visible.
A well-maintained appliance can help your team stay consistent. On the other hand, a neglected appliance can create repeated issues: unsafe temperatures, standing water, food debris, grease buildup, odor, pest attraction, and inconsistent performance.
That is why appliance maintenance should be treated as part of your food safety system, not just a repair task.
Restaurant Health Inspection Appliance Tips for Daily Readiness
The best inspection preparation is a daily routine. If appliance checks only happen once in a while, small problems can build up quietly.
Start With a Daily Appliance Walkthrough
Before service begins, assign a manager or trained staff member to complete a quick appliance check. This does not need to take long, but it should be consistent.
Check the following:
- Are refrigerators and freezers holding proper temperatures?
- Are prep coolers cold enough before food is loaded?
- Are gaskets clean and sealing tightly?
- Are appliance thermometers visible and working?
- Are dishwasher temperatures or sanitizer levels being checked?
- Are food-contact surfaces clean to sight and touch?
- Are drip trays, filters, and vents clean?
- Is there standing water under any appliance?
- Are there unusual noises, smells, leaks, or error codes?
- Are cords, plugs, and outlets in safe condition?
This habit gives your team a chance to correct issues before they affect food, service, or inspection results.
Keep a Written Temperature and Maintenance Log
A written log is useful because it shows consistency. It also helps you identify patterns before they become breakdowns.
For example, if a walk-in cooler slowly rises from normal temperature over several days, the log may reveal the trend before food becomes unsafe. If a dishwasher sanitizer level is inconsistent, the log may show whether the issue happens during peak hours, after chemical replacement, or after a machine cycle change.
A simple log can include:
- Date and time
- Appliance name
- Temperature reading
- Staff initials
- Corrective action taken
- Repair notes
- Follow-up check
The log does not need to be complicated. It needs to be accurate and used consistently.
Refrigeration Equipment: The First Place to Pay Attention
Refrigerators, walk-in coolers, reach-in coolers, undercounter units, prep tables, and freezers are some of the most important appliances in a restaurant. They are also among the most common places where temperature problems appear.
Check Cold Holding Before Food Is Loaded
A prep cooler may seem fine when empty, but struggle once loaded with pans of food. Therefore, check the temperature before loading and again during service.
Pay close attention to:
- Walk-in coolers
- Reach-in refrigerators
- Prep coolers
- Sandwich/salad stations
- Undercounter refrigerators
- Display cases
- Freezers
- Ice cream freezers
If a unit is already warm before service, do not rely on it to protect food during a rush.
Inspect Door Gaskets and Hinges
Door gaskets are easy to overlook, but they are essential. A torn or loose gasket allows warm air to enter, causing the unit to work harder and temperatures to fluctuate.
Look for:
- Cracked rubber
- Loose corners
- Food debris in gasket folds
- Doors that do not close fully
- Condensation around the door
- Frost buildup near the seal
- Hinges that sag or misalign the door
A weak gasket may seem minor, but it can lead to unsafe temperatures, energy waste, and compressor strain.
Clean Condenser Coils and Keep Airflow Clear
Commercial kitchens produce grease, dust, flour, and lint. These particles can collect around refrigeration coils and vents. When airflow is blocked, the cooling system cannot release heat efficiently.
As a result, the unit may run constantly, fail to hold temperature, or break down during a busy shift.
Make sure staff know not to stack boxes, towels, or supplies around refrigeration vents. Also, schedule coil cleaning based on kitchen conditions. A high-volume kitchen may need more frequent cleaning than a low-volume operation.
Watch for Refrigeration Warning Signs
Call for service if you notice:
- Temperature rising repeatedly
- Compressor running constantly
- Ice or frost where it should not be
- Water pooling near the unit
- Fans not spinning
- Clicking, buzzing, or grinding sounds
- Door not sealing
- Food not staying cold
- Error codes on digital controls
A refrigeration problem should be handled quickly because it affects food safety, inventory cost, and daily operations.
Dishwasher and Warewashing Equipment Tips
Dishwashing equipment is a major part of inspection readiness because plates, utensils, cutting boards, pans, and kitchen tools must be properly cleaned and sanitized.
A dishwasher that looks clean on the outside may still fail to sanitize correctly if temperatures, chemical levels, spray arms, filters, or drains are not working properly.
Check Sanitizing Performance
Depending on your dishwasher type, sanitizing may depend on hot water temperature or chemical sanitizer. Either way, staff should know how to verify that the machine is working correctly.
Daily checks may include:
- Final rinse temperature
- Chemical sanitizer concentration
- Detergent levels
- Rinse aid levels
- Water pressure
- Spray arm movement
- Drain function
- Machine error codes
If staff are not checking these items, a dishwasher problem may go unnoticed until dishes come out dirty or an inspector asks questions.
Clean Filters, Screens, and Spray Arms
Food debris can block water flow and reduce cleaning performance. Remove and clean filters according to the manufacturer’s instructions. Also, inspect spray arms for clogged holes.
Common dishwasher red flags include:
- Dishes come out greasy
- Glasses look cloudy
- Food particles remain on plates
- The machine smells bad
- Water pools at the bottom
- The machine does not drain fully
- Spray arms do not spin freely
- Sanitizer readings are inconsistent
When these signs appear, do not keep running the machine and hoping the next cycle fixes it. Find the cause.
Ice Machine Maintenance Before Inspection
Ice is food. Because of that, ice machines should be treated with the same seriousness as any food-contact equipment.
An ice machine can collect slime, mineral buildup, mold, and debris if it is not cleaned correctly. In a busy restaurant, staff may focus on visible kitchen surfaces while forgetting the inside of the ice bin, chute, scoop holder, and surrounding area.
Ice Machine Inspection Checklist
Check these areas regularly:
- Ice bin interior
- Ice chute
- Scoop and scoop holder
- Exterior vents
- Water filter
- Drain line
- Door or lid gasket
- Surrounding floor area
- Signs of slime, residue, or odor
The ice scoop should never be stored directly in the ice with the handle touching the ice. Keep it in a clean holder and wash it regularly.
When an Ice Machine Needs Service
Call for service if the ice machine:
- Produces cloudy or strange-smelling ice
- Leaks water
- Makes loud noises
- Produces less ice than usual
- Shows error codes
- Has repeated mineral buildup
- Does not drain correctly
- Has visible residue returning quickly after cleaning
Ice machine issues can affect both safety and customer experience, so they should not be ignored.
Cooking Equipment: Ovens, Ranges, Griddles, and Fryers
Cooking equipment may not always be associated with cold holding violations, but it still matters during inspection. Grease buildup, poor cleaning, uneven heating, and damaged components can create food safety and fire safety concerns.
Keep Cooking Surfaces Clean and Functional
Cooking equipment should be cleaned throughout the day and deep-cleaned on a schedule. Grease and food residue can attract pests, create odors, produce smoke, and affect cooking performance.
Pay attention to:
- Burner ports
- Griddle surfaces
- Fryer baskets
- Fryer oil quality
- Oven racks
- Oven door gaskets
- Hood filters
- Control knobs
- Drip trays
- Grease collection areas
If cooking equipment is not heating evenly, food may not cook as expected. That can affect product quality and, in some cases, food safety.
Fryer Maintenance Matters
Fryers are high-use appliances in many restaurants. Poor fryer maintenance can lead to smoke, oil breakdown, off-flavors, and equipment strain.
A fryer maintenance routine should include:
- Filtering oil as needed
- Cleaning crumbs from the cold zone
- Checking thermostat accuracy
- Inspecting baskets
- Watching for slow recovery time
- Cleaning exterior grease buildup
- Scheduling service for gas or electrical issues
If a fryer takes too long to recover temperature or overheats, it may need calibration or repair.
Hot Holding and Warming Equipment
Hot holding units, steam tables, soup wells, heat lamps, and warming drawers must perform consistently. If hot holding equipment cannot maintain safe temperatures, food may enter the danger zone.
Check Equipment Before Service
Do not wait until food is already in the unit. Preheat hot holding equipment and verify that it is working correctly before loading food.
Look for:
- Uneven heat
- Cold spots
- Broken controls
- Loose knobs
- Water level issues in steam tables
- Damaged pans or inserts
- Poor lid fit
- Food drying out too quickly
A hot holding unit that “kind of works” can become a problem during an inspection or rush period.
Prep Equipment and Food-Contact Surfaces
Mixers, slicers, food processors, blenders, scales, prep tables, and cutting equipment must be cleaned and maintained carefully.
Food-Contact Equipment Must Be Easy to Clean
Equipment with cracks, damaged seals, missing guards, rust, or rough surfaces can be difficult to clean properly. Inspectors may pay attention to whether equipment is cleanable, in good repair, and free from buildup.
Check:
- Slicer blades and guards
- Mixer attachments
- Blender bases and gaskets
- Food processor parts
- Prep table surfaces
- Cutting boards
- Can openers
- Scales
- Seams and joints where food can collect
The can opener is a classic example. It is small, but it can collect food debris quickly and become a sanitation issue if overlooked.
Create a “Breakdown Cleaning” Schedule
Some equipment needs to be disassembled for proper cleaning. Staff should know which parts come apart, how to clean them, how to sanitize them, and how to reassemble them safely.
A visual checklist near the prep area can help reduce missed steps.
Ventilation and Hood System Awareness
The hood system is not a typical “appliance,” but it supports appliance safety and kitchen conditions. Poor ventilation can increase heat, smoke, grease buildup, and staff discomfort.
Signs Ventilation Is Not Keeping Up
Watch for:
- Smoke lingering in the kitchen
- Excess heat near cooking lines
- Grease collecting quickly on surfaces
- Strong cooking odors
- Hood filters dripping grease
- Staff discomfort near the line
- Appliances overheating nearby
Clean hood filters regularly and follow professional hood cleaning schedules. A dirty ventilation system can affect kitchen safety and overall cleanliness.
Common Appliance Issues That Can Hurt Inspection Readiness
Some appliance problems are more likely to create inspection concerns than others.
Temperature Control Problems
These include refrigerators, freezers, prep coolers, and hot holding equipment not maintaining safe temperatures. This is one of the most important categories because it directly affects food safety.
Dirty Food-Contact Surfaces
If a slicer, blender, ice machine, prep table, or mixer has visible residue, it can raise sanitation concerns.
Leaks and Standing Water
Water under refrigerators, dishwashers, ice machines, or sinks can suggest drainage problems, create slip hazards, and attract pests.
Damaged Gaskets, Seals, or Surfaces
Cracked gaskets, broken handles, rusted shelves, and damaged food-contact surfaces can make equipment harder to clean and less reliable.
Pest Attraction
Food debris behind appliances, grease under cooking equipment, and standing water can attract pests. Even if pest control is active, appliance-related sanitation gaps can contribute to the problem.

When to Call an Appliance Repair Technician
Maintenance can prevent many problems, but it cannot fix everything. If an appliance repeatedly fails temperature checks, leaks, overheats, trips breakers, or shows error codes, it should be inspected professionally.
Call a technician when:
- A cooler cannot hold temperature
- A freezer develops heavy frost
- A dishwasher will not sanitize properly
- An ice machine leaks or produces poor ice
- A fryer has slow temperature recovery
- An oven heats unevenly
- A hot holding unit has cold spots
- A dryer or washer in a restaurant setting malfunctions
- A machine makes unusual noises
- Electrical components smell burnt
- A control panel fails or glitches
Professional repair helps protect food safety, reduce downtime, and avoid repeated violations caused by the same equipment problem.
